The mesophotic zone in the open ocean is considered to be from 200m down to 1000m (600-3000ft.) where the sunlight of the surface fades throught the twilight and into the inky blackness of the deep.
In nearshore habitats the mesophotic zone ranges from 50-60m past 300m+ (150-1000ft.) because sediment, plankton, and organic matter produced by coastal habitats absorb light much more rapidly than in the crystal clear open ocean. The bathymetry of Curacao is unique with several tiers of fossil and living reef that drop off very quickly and the waters close to shore reach a maximum of 330m (1000ft.). The shallow reefs of Curacao are quite healthy and diverse but the traditional photosynthetic reef paradigm changes abruptly to a mesophotic system because of the rapid depth changes.

Below you can watch a short teaser video from the inside of an aquarium of deepwater fishes including Pugnose Bass (Bullisichthys加拿大),Heliotrope Bass(Lipogramma klayi), and Banded Basslets (Lipogramma evides). These fishes are all from depths of 70m (230ft.) down to 155m (500ft.) and went through an extensive decompression and accilmation process before landing in the display tank. Many of the mesophotic fishes collected by the Smithsonian and Substation Curacao are predators on small crustaceans, mollusks, and zooplankton which is fortunate for the husbandry team because they readily accept live mysis shrimp.
